Solovki.ca is an online encyclopedia dedicated to the Solovki Islands, offering you a deep dive into their unique history, culture, and natural beauty. Whether you're interested in the renowned Solovetsky Monastery, the islands' religious significance, or their role in Russian history, you'll find well-organized articles and resources in Russian and English.
You can explore sections on local saints, the infamous Solovki Gulag, cultural events, and the geography of the archipelago. The site also features book excerpts, maps, nature guides, and updates on current events related to Solovki.
